Another side installment in the popular Angry Birds series developed by Rovio. The story of the game is linked to the animated movie released in 2016. The main character of the game and the movie is a bird named Red. The protagonist wakes up with a hangover after a party and discovers that during the night someone destroyed the whole village. Sadly, all the evidence points to Red. He will have to prove his innocence. The gameplay of Angry Birds Action! combines the characteristic traits of the Angry Birds series with pinball elements. On each level of the game player is tasked with leading the protagonist to the eggs in order to save them. There is a limited number of moves available for completing the task. Character controls are similar as in other installments of the series, but this time the whole action takes place on the ground. The player must shoot Red in such way that the bird will slide and bounce from various obstacles until he reaches the target. Various objects with different properties and useful bonuses scattered across the map to make the game more interesting.

A third installment in the Pinball FX series. In the game developed by Zen Studios, the player can try out new, themed pinball machines, as well as import most of the machines from Pinball FX2 and Zen Pinball 2. The game attempts to translate the real pinball experience into a video game setting. The player is tasked with bouncing the ball with the so-called flippers located at the bottom of the table to hit multiple targets and keep the ball in the game for as long as possible, before it falls into the drain located at the bottom of the play field, below the flippers. The objective of the game is to earn the best score possible. In comparison to the previous installments in the series, Pinball FX3 puts a much stronger emphasis on the multiplayer experience as well as social aspects of the game. The players can enter friendly matches, compete within an online league and tournaments organized by the fans themselves. Moreover, the game delivers several single player modes allowing the player to increase their skills and familiarize themselves with general rules.

The second installment of the popular flipper simulator, which is an improved and tweaked version of the original, released in 2007 by the team of Hungarian ZEN Studios. The title offers the mechanics known from the first part, but brings a lot of changes in technical matters. First of all, the graphic design of the game has been improved, as well as the physics of the cue ball's behavior and the behavior of individual table elements, which can be further modified using a special operator menu.
